Navigating the world of assets can be daunting, especially when considering precious metals like gold as a potential hedge against inflation and economic uncertainty. Two popular options for incorporating gold into your financial strategy are Gold IRAs and gold bullion. Each offers unique advantages and disadvantages, making it essential to understand the nuances before making a decision. A Gold IRA allows you to invest in gold-backed securities within a tax-advantaged retirement account. This can offer significant tax benefits, potentially accelerating your wealth building. However, investing in a Gold IRA typically involves account maintenance costs, which can impact your overall returns. On the other hand, purchasing physical gold provides tangible ownership and {eliminates counterparty risk|. However, storing and safeguarding physical gold can be inconvenient, requiring secure storage solutions and potentially incurring storage expenses.

Retirement Planning Power Play: Gold IRA vs. 401(k)
Deciding between a Gold IRA and a traditional 401(k) can feel like navigating a financial labyrinth. Both offer valuable avenues for retirement savings, but understanding their distinct attributes is crucial. A Gold IRA, as the name suggests, invests your assets in physical gold, potentially mitigating against inflation and market instability. On the other side, a 401(k) is a employer-sponsored plan that enables contributions from both you and your employer. These contributions grow tax-deferred, offering potential for significant long-term profit.
When comparing these options, consider your individual risk tolerance. A Gold IRA might resonate investors seeking inflation hedging, while a 401(k) could be a more traditional choice for long-term growth.
